    타이틀 Wind Tunnel Evaluation of Airfoil Performance Using Simulated Ice Shapes
    저자 M.B. Bragg, R.J. Zaguli, and G.M. Gregorek
    Keyword Airfoil icing; Computational fluid mechanics; Wind tunnel testing
    URL http://gltrs.grc.nasa.gov/reports/1982/CR-167960.pdf
    보고서번호 NASA CR-167960
    발행년도 1982
    출처 NASA Glenn Research Center
    ABSTRACT Until recently very little experimental data has been available on the performance degradation of airfoil sections resulting from rime or glaze ice accretions. The test program described in this report provides some of this needed information. Its primary objectives were: (1) To examine a method of simulating ice accretions with wood shapes which were instrumented with surface pressure taps to obtain detailed aerodynamic data; (2) To study the complex flowfield in the area of the ice accretion through these pressure distributions; and (3) To evaluate the accuracy of the theoretical analysis methods presently utilized. This paper is primarily a data report and presents information taken on the 63A415 airfoil. Further analysis on other classes of airfoils is required to fully analyze the icing problem and to refine conclusions drawn from the results of this test.
